Force Peak force can only be reset to zero if live force is zero Peak force will reset to match live force The EDjr has two display modes accessible by pressing the Mode soft key See Figure 4 The first display mode when you power up is the live force measurement mode Press the Mode soft key and the display changes to peak measurement mode This mode shows the peak force applied to the EDjr since the last peak clearing action Delete the peak reading by pressing the Clear soft key Press the Mode soft key again and the display returns to the force measure ment mode Follow these steps to perform a gross force measurement 1 Turn on the unit with the On Off key 2 Remove any weight from the EDjr 3 Zero the EDjr by pressing the ZERO key 4 Apply the force to the EDjr and read the gross force on the display You can change the units of measure of the display by pressing the Units Soft key Zero reference is maintained after instrument power off and will be recalled with the next power on Zero reference may be lost if battery power is removed Rezeroing allows the weight or load of fixturing to be invisible to the mea surement The zeroed load must always be considered as part of the maximum capacity 1 Turn on the unit with the On Off key 2 Remove any weight from the EDjr 3 Zero the EDjr by pressing the ZERO key 4 Apply the tare force to the EDjr and press the ZERO key 5 Apply the force to the EDjr and

Load Zero Lists the number of overloads that have occurred since the unit was manufactured Lists the current zero point compared to the calibration zero point If the zero point has moved significantly this may indicate a serious overload has occurred and the instrument should be returned for service The Test functions can help service technicians remotely diagnose your Dillon instrument by showing information on key internal functions Typically these menus will have significance only to trained technicians You may look at these menus without technical guidance but the information may have little meaning or an error may be reported that may not exist Press this key to access several items described below refer to Figure 3 Batt Disp Keys Press this key to perform a battery test This shows the battery level in A D counts and approximate voltage Voltage is not calibrated Press this key to test the A D section of the EDjr You need to apply force to change the counts and test the unit The A D is the electronics portion that converts analog load cell signal to digital numbers Press this key to perform a display test Stop the test by press ing the ESC key Press this key to perform key tests Any key pressed will be reflected in the display Press ESC to end the test EDjunior Dynamometer User s Manual EDjr Operation Display Modes Force Measurement Force Measurement Rezero Displaying Peak

6. d above the rated capacity Doing so can significantly impact fatigue life of the instrument and cause premature and abrupt failure If a higher capacity reading is needed Dillon insists that a larger instrument be used Safety is always a concern in overhead lifting and tensioning applications To limit your liability always insist upon factory supplied shackles and pins and factory tested and certified safe optional equipment All DILLON prod ucts are designed to meet the published Safe Working Load SWL and Ultimate Safety Factor USF standards of the United States Military Do not grind stamp or deform the metal on the dynamometer body in any way Any significant damage or deformation to the loading element is cause for evaluation by Dillon particularly in the element side members to the right and left of the display Relieve all torsional and off axis loads Apply load in the center of the shackle bow with this instrument Off center loading results in substandard performance Instrument requires time to stabilize when changing temperatures Use only the hardware supplied with this instrument If no hardware was supplied insure that the mating pin and shackle bow is equivalent to the hardware used at calibration Otherwise substandard performance can result Dillon recommends only using qualified rigging hardware and cannot be responsible for unapproved hardware This instrument is not designed for the following Applica
7. ey to enable or disable the display flash feedback If enabled the press of a key causes the display to momentarily flash to give you a visual feedback that the key was activated Press this soft key to enable or disable the Zero key s ability to also clear the Peak force value If you enable this function press the Zero key to clear the Peak force and zero the load If you disable the function the Zero key will only zero the load Peak force remains in effect and will only be cleared with the Clear function during operation Press this key to adjust the contrast of the LCD display Press the Down soft key to lighten the contrast Press the Up soft key to darken the contrast There is a keypad shortcut for increasing and decreasing contrast While in normal display mode press Arrow key and F2 simultaneously to increase contrast Press Arrow key and F1 simultaneously to decrease contrast The next soft key is the About The About menu shows an assortment of information about your Dillon instrument This can be handy for maintaining calibration troubleshooting or determining if the firmware can be upgraded Press this and access the following soft key set refer to Figure 3 Device Press this to see software revision and dynamometer informa tion Calib This soft key access the following soft key set Points Press this key to display the calibration loading points EDjunior Dynamometer User s Manual 9 Setup Test 10 O

11. tions that see rapid dramatic temperature swings or thermal shock Wide variation in readings can occur Environments with high electromagnetic fields such as cranes employ ing electromagnets to lift metal These induce trace voltages that are picked up within the load cell lead wiring and appear as inaccurate loads Intrinsically safe environments This unit has not been Factory Mutual tested EDjunior Dynamometer User s Manual Weighing and Force Measurement Practice The basis for all electronic force measurement or weighing is measurement of stress in a loadcell body To obtain optimal results it is necessary to establish a few basic rules otherwise the effect may be a nonlinear or non repeatable response Read and follow these tips and see the illustrations on the next page For accurate performance the force acting on the unit must be in line with Load Centering a Insure shackles are oriented parallel with the instrument Apply load in the Alignment center of the shackle bow A proper fitting pin is important in order to generate an even stress distribu tion and avoid yield stresses To achieve published accuracy you must use the shackle pins provided by Dillon Proper Pin Fit Torque and bending should be avoided Use swivels on the lifting wire for Torque and Bending anti torque and avoid side forces Certified shackles and lifting gear should always be used in accordance to local laws and federal legislation
